Frequently Asked Questions

What new 9mm ammunition is the FBI using?

The FBI has selected Federal Premium for lead-free, match-grade training ammunition and Hornady Critical Duty 135gr +P for their duty 9mm rounds, marking a significant shift back to 9mm.

What are the features of the Dead Air Odessa-9 suppressor?

The Dead Air Odessa-9 is a modular 9mm pistol suppressor featuring up to 11 user-adjustable baffles for customizable length and sound suppression. It has an MSRP of $899 and a 1.1-inch diameter.

How do Ultradyne C4 backup sights improve aiming?

Ultradyne C4 sights utilize a unique two-circle reticle system designed to aid in faster target acquisition. They also offer windage adjustments and various MOA options for the front sight circle.

What advice is given for gun rights advocacy?

Effective gun rights advocacy involves becoming a local voice, engaging directly with politicians through conversation, and encouraging others to participate, rather than solely relying on donations or generic actions.
